Key Factors Influencing Global Trading Markets

Economic indicators play a significant role in shaping global trading markets. Data such as GDP growth, employment rates, and consumer spending provide valuable insights into market conditions. Investors use this information to assess potential risks and opportunities.

Geopolitical events also have a profound impact on financial markets. Changes in government policies, international relations, and trade agreements can influence investor sentiment and market stability. Staying informed about global developments is crucial for making strategic trading decisions.

Technological advancements continue to revolutionize trading practices. From automated trading systems to real-time data analysis, technology enables faster and more efficient decision-making. Sterile Water For Peptides

Sterile water for peptides is a vital component in the preparation and reconstitution of peptide powders prior to use. Unlike bacteriostatic water, sterile water contains no preservatives, making it suitable for single‑use applications where additives could interfere with sensitive compounds. Its uncontaminated nature ensures that peptides dissolve consistently, preserving their structure and activity for accurate dosing.

Peptides are short chains of amino acids that can be delicate and sensitive to impurities. Using sterile water helps eliminate the risk of introducing microbes or particulates that could degrade the peptide or affect downstream applications. This makes sterile water essential for laboratory research, pharmaceutical formulation, and other scientific workflows where precision matters.

Proper Usage and Handling

Before mixing peptides, familiarize yourself with sterile technique — a set of practices used to prevent contamination during preparation. Aseptic practices involve using sterile syringes, disinfecting vial stoppers, and avoiding contact with non‑sterile surfaces. Learning about autoclaving can provide insight into how sterile environments are maintained, as this process uses pressurized steam to eliminate microorganisms from equipment.

Always check the sterile water vial for clarity and intact seals before use. Any signs of cloudiness or damage may indicate compromised sterility. By combining high‑quality sterile water with meticulous technique, you help ensure that peptides dissolve cleanly and your results remain reliable.…

Detecting Early Roof Issues

Roof repair Toronto is essential for preventing small concerns from turning into major structural problems. Most roofing systems are designed to last for decades, but they are constantly exposed to sunlight, rain, wind, and temperature changes that gradually weaken materials. One of the earliest signs of trouble is shingle deterioration. Homeowners may notice curling edges, cracked surfaces, or missing granules collecting in gutters. These subtle warning signs indicate that shingles are losing their protective capabilities. Additionally, dark streaks or moss growth on the roof surface can signal trapped moisture, which may accelerate material breakdown. Inside the home, faint water stains on ceilings or walls often serve as the first visible evidence of a developing leak.

Another critical step in early detection involves inspecting the attic. Damp insulation, musty odors, or visible daylight coming through the roof boards may reveal hidden vulnerabilities. Checking fl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ights is equally important, as these areas are prone to separation and corrosion over time. Early roof issues are not always dramatic; they often begin with minor weaknesses that slowly worsen. By identifying small irregularities early, homeowners can schedule minor repairs rather than face expensive replacements later.

Routine Inspections as a Preventative Strategy

Routine inspections—ideally twice a year—are the most effective method for detecting roof issues early. Spring and fall checks allow homeowners to identify damage caused by seasonal weather shifts. Using binoculars from the ground can help spot uneven surfaces or missing shingles safely. Professional inspections provide even deeper insight, uncovering structural or ventilation problems that may not be visible externally. Consistent monitoring, combined with prompt repairs, preserves the roof’s structural integrity and extends its overall lifespan.…
